From Traditional Setups to Integrated Design

Traditional speaker setups frequently put form and function in conflict. Tower speakers dominate rooms, wall-mounted systems create visual clutter, and exposed wires pose safety hazards. These limitations often left homeowners forced to choose between enjoying quality sound or preserving the visual harmony of their spaces.

Cabinetry integration changes that approach. Instead of placing equipment into a room after the fact, the audio system becomes part of the design itself. Speakers are recessed behind acoustically transparent panels, subwoofers are built into furniture-style enclosures, and amplifiers are housed in ventilated compartments. The result is a sound system that is both functional and discreet.

Sound Performance Without Compromise

A common concern is whether concealing speakers behind cabinetry diminishes sound quality. Properly executed, the opposite occurs. Acoustically transparent materials, carefully designed enclosures, and proper airflow ensure that equipment functions at full capacity.

In many cases, cabinetry improves performance by stabilizing speakers and eliminating vibrations or sound reflections that occur with less structured setups. This ensures clarity and balance while maintaining the integrity of the home’s design.

Practical Benefits

The advantages extend beyond aesthetics and performance. Integrated cabinetry keeps wires, remotes, and accessories organized and out of sight, reducing clutter and improving safety for families with children. Properly ventilated compartments extend the lifespan of electronic components by keeping them cool and protected.

Consolidating equipment also simplifies daily use. With everything housed in a central, accessible system, managing audio becomes more straightforward.
